Holiday Shop: Wreath Making Workshop

During this hands-on experience, guests will be guided through a sustainable – circular – approach to wreath making, helping you to craft a stunning wreath that can be enjoyed throughout its full lifecycle. You’ll work with an assortment of materials, including fresh florals, lush greens, and innovative accents, allowing you to personalize your creation to your heart’s desire.

Workshop runs from 1pm – 3pm.

No previous experience is required.
